This time Slava has prepared interesting lessons with a focus on exploring during class. Here is what he says about the topics…

6 November

18.00 -19.00 "How i would dance this song?". Or "What we can mark here?.." (as well as "what we should" and "what's not the best idea..") It's a sort of the Musical Laboratory. All the class we work with a chosen song. (For this time it's gonna be "Farol" by Pugliese). The idea is to explore it from the beginning till the end. We listen, we find "what to mark". We decide "how". We try.

19.00 – 20.00 Dynamics. "Legato". This is one of my favorite topics. The main idea is "to keep the flow“. We will work with "connection” or “linking” of steps. Which means how we “link” different steps so they start to look as one nice smooth movement. When I write “look” I mean not just how a dancing couple looks like, but how we “feel” the movement inside the couple. Or in other words – how to make a set of different steps to be a Dance.

8 November

13.00 – 14.00 Reverse TangoLab. Exploring of the Movement. From A to Z and from Z to A. (reverse movements) We “flip” familiar figures and explore reversed movements. The goal: to break habits, stay present, and deepen connection. After working on a couple of simple changings of direction using the reverse idea, I added two new ways to play with double-time to my "vocabulary". Two new “one-and-two” patterns made from simple steps and weight shifts that, in 25 years, never occurred to me before!
